Established on 24 December , D.M. Consunji, Inc. (DMCI) is one of the leading engineering-based integrated construction firms in the country.

It operates in four key construction segments: building, energy, infrastructure, and utilities and plants.

Over the years, its pioneering methodologies and expertise have allowed it to complete high-rise buildings, toll roads, bridges, power plants and water facilities of varying scale and complexity.

DMCI is at the forefront of building important and technically challenging structures that will improve lives, sustain communities and enable growth in the Philippines.

In , a young engineer named David M. Consunji founded his namesake company to take advantage of the postwar construction boom in Manila. He believed in the value and nobility of principled contracting, and inspired a generation of engineers with his passion to build and commitment to serve.

D.M. Consunji, Inc. (DMCI) would go on to build landmarks and key infrastructure in the Philippines and other parts of the world, becoming one of the largest and most reputable construction companies in the country.

His training to becoming one of the most revered men in the Philippines began even before he was born. David Mendoza Consunji is the second son out of a brood of 9 kids of Gaudencio Consunji and Consuelo Mendoza. The stories of his parents laid the groundwork towards a strong foundation of perseverance, humility, passion, determination, the eye for detail and quality and compassion as David Consunji would come to be known. 

 

The kind of life that his parents decided to go for their kids exposed DM to many experiences that molded his character. Even if he came from a well-off family, David and his siblings spent their early years in the province of Bataan. It is here where they learned to value the lessons that spring from having a simple life, because where they were presented a simple lifestyle. The daily challenges and tasks inculcated in them the value of hardwork, and more importantly the value of doing anything with your own hands.
